Output f58d5f0133a679c3fad68698afa114b8da76f68b0a74b011f5fc2e2c08bb5664:0

value
1551629314001
script pubkey
OP_PUSHNUM_8 OP_PUSHBYTES_32 50eb12a48a8fd7d0fd27ce15739781f190a1ab8fdf7facb6050dad8a5f85e54b
address
ltc1g2r439fy23ltaplf8ec2h89up7xg2r2u0mal6eds9pkkc5hu9u49s76nn9h
transaction
f58d5f0133a679c3fad68698afa114b8da76f68b0a74b011f5fc2e2c08bb5664
spent
true